Liverpool manager, Klopp speaks on replacing Low as Germany head coach
Liverpool manager, Jurgen Klopp, has ruled out any possibility of replacing Joachim Low as Germany head coach this summer. On Tuesday, Low, who led Germany to glory at the 2014 World Cup, announced his decision to step down as Germany head coach after Euro 2020, which is taking place at the end of the season.

Northern Christians will be granted political asylum in Biafra – Nnamdi Kanu
Nnamdi Kanu, leader of the Indigenous People of Biafra, IPOB, has said Northern Christians have nothing to worry about concerning Nigeria’s disintegration. Kanu declared that the Northern Christian community would be granted political asylum in Biafra when it cedes from Nigeria.
